Both mindreading and stereotyping are forms of social cognition that play a pervasive role in our everyday lives, yet too little attention has been paid to the question of how these two processes are related. This paper offers a theory of the influence of stereotyping on mental-state attribution that draws on hierarchical predictive coding accounts of action prediction. It is argued that the key to understanding the relation between stereotyping and mindreading lies in the fact that stereotypes centrally involve (...) character-trait attributions, which play a systematic role in the action–prediction hierarchy. On this view, when we apply a stereotype to an individual, we rapidly attribute to her a cluster of generic character traits on the basis of her perceived social group membership. These traits are then used to make inferences about that individual’s likely beliefs and desires, which in turn inform inferences about her behavior. (shrink)

Traditionally, theories of mindreading have focused on the representation of beliefs and desires. However, decades of social psychology and social neuroscience have shown that, in addition to reasoning about beliefs and desires, human beings also use representations of character traits to predict and interpret behavior. While a few recent accounts have attempted to accommodate these findings, they have not succeeded in explaining the relation between trait attribution and belief-desire reasoning. On my account, character-trait attribution is part of a hierarchical system (...) for action prediction, and serves to inform hypotheses about agents’ beliefs and desires, which are in turn used to predict and interpret behavior. False belief tasks have enjoyed a monopoly in the research on children?s development of a theory of mind. They have been granted this status because they promise to deliver an unambiguous assessment of children?s understanding of the representational nature of mental states. Their poor cousins, true belief tasks, have been relegated to occasional service as control tasks. That this is their only role has been due to the universal assumption that correct answers on true belief tasks are inherently (...) ambiguous regarding the level of the child?s understanding of mental states. It has also been due to the universal assumption that nothing in the child?s developing theory of mind would lead to systematically incorrect answers on true belief tasks. We review new findings that 4- and 5- year -olds do err, systematically and profoundly, on the true belief versions of all the extant belief tasks. This reveals an intermediate level of understanding in the development of children?s theory of mind. Researchers have been unaware of this intermediate level because it produces correct answers in false belief tasks. A simple two- task battery?one true belief task and one false belief task?is sufficient to remove the ambiguity from each task. The new findings show that children do not acquire an understanding of beliefs, and hence a representational theory of mind, until after 6 years of age, or 2 years later than most developmental psychologists have concluded. This raises the question of how to interpret other new findings that infants are able to pass false belief tasks. We review these new infant studies, as well as recent studies on chimpanzees, in light of older children?s failure on true belief tasks, and end with some speculation about how all of these new findings might be reconciled. Background. The literature on Theory of Mind (ToM) in antisocial samples is limited despite evidence that the neural substrates of theory of mind task involve the same circuits implicated in the pathogenesis of antisocial behaviour. Method. Eighty-nine male DSM-IV Antisocial Personality Disordered subjects (ASPDs) and 20 controls (matched for age and IQ) completed a battery of ToM tasks. The ASPD group was categorized into psychopathic and non-psychopathic groups based on a cut-off score of 18 on the (...) Psychopathy Checklist: Screening Version. Results. There were no significant group (control v. psychopath v. non-psychopathic ASPD) dif- ferences on basic tests of ToM but both psychopathic and non-psychopathic ASPDs performed worse on subtle tests of mentalizing ability (faux pas tasks). ASPDs can detect and understand faux pas, but show an indifference to the impact of faux pas. On the face/eye task non-psychopathic ASPDs showed impairments in the recognition of basic emotions compared with controls and psychopathic ASPDs. For complex emotions, no significant group differences were detected largely due to task difficulty. Conclusions. The deficits in mentalizing ability in ASPD are subtle. For the majority of criminals with ASPD and psychopathy ToM abilities are relatively intact and may have an adaptive function in maintaining a criminal lifestyle. Our findings suggest the key deficits appear to relate more to their lack of concern about the impact on potential victims than the inability to take a victim perspective. The findings tentatively also suggest that ASPDs with neurotic features may be more impaired in mentalizing ability than their low anxious psychopathic counterparts. (shrink)

The concept of acting intentionally is an important nexus where ‘theory of mind’ and moral judgment meet. Preschool children’s judgments of intentional action show a valence-driven asymmetry. Children say that a foreseen but disavowed side-effect is brought about 'on purpose' when the side-effect itself is morally bad but not when it is morally good. This is the first demonstration in preschoolers that moral judgment influences judgments of ‘on-purpose’ (as opposed to purpose influencing moral judgment). Judgments of intentional action (...) are usually assumed to be purely factual. That these judgments are sometimes partly normative — even in preschoolers — challenges current understanding. Young children’s judgments regarding foreseen side-effects depend upon whether the children process the idea that the character does not care about the side-effect. As soon as preschoolers effectively process the ‘theory of mind’ concept, NOT CARE THAT P, children show the side-effect effect.idea.. (shrink)

My aim in what follows is to expound and (if possible) resolve two problems in Spinoza’s theory of mind. The first problem is how Spinoza can accept a key premise in Descartes’s argument for dualism—that thought and extension are separately conceivable, “one without the help of the other”—without accepting Descartes’s conclusion that no substance is both thinking and extended. Resolving this problem will require us to consider a crucial ambiguity in the notion of conceiving one thing without another, (...) the credentials of Descartes’s principle that each substance has a principal attribute, and the prospect of neutral monism as a theory of the mind. The second problem is how Spinoza can maintain that each mental event is identical with some physical event (and conversely) while denying that there is ever any causal interaction between mental and physical events. If one mental event causes another and the first is identical with some physical event, must that physical event not cause the mental event? Resolving this problem will require looking into the reach of opacity in Spinoza’s philosophy and considering whether there are ever any legitimate exceptions to Leibniz’s Law. (shrink)

This chapter will argue that the criminal law is most compatible with a specific theory regarding the mind/body relationship: non-eliminative reductionism. Criminal responsibility rests upon mental causation: a defendant is found criminally responsible for an act where she possesses certain culpable mental states (mens rea under the law) that are causally related to criminal harm. If we assume the widely accepted position of ontological physicalism, which holds that only one sort of thing exists in the world – physical (...) stuff – non-eliminative reductive physicalism about the mind offers the most plausible account of the full-bodied mental causation criminal responsibility requires. Other theories of the mind/body relationship, including elminativism and non-reductive physicalism, threaten criminal responsibility because they do not offer satisfactory accounts of mental causation. Eliminativism, as the name implies, eliminates the mental or is skeptical that it can do the causal work necessary to responsibility; and non-reductive theories disconnect the mental from the physical/casual world such that the mental can no longer have reliable causal effects. Elements of Mind (EM) has two themes, one major and one minor. The major theme is intentionality, the mind’s direction upon its objects; the other is the mind–body problem. I treat these themes separately: chapters 1, and 3–5 are concerned with intentionality, while chapter 2 is about the mind–body problem. In this summary I will first describe my view of the mind–body problem, and then describe the book’s main theme. Like many philosophers, I see the (...)mind–body problem as containing two sub–problems: the problem of mental causation and the problem of consciousness. I see these problems forming the two horns of a dilemma. Just as the problem of mental causation pushes us towards physicalism, so the problem of consciousness pushes us away from it. Each problem reveals the inadequacy of the solution to the other. Essentially the problem of mental causation is the conflict between (i) the apparent fact that mental states and events have effects in the physical world and (ii) a general principle about the causal nature of the physical world, which is sometimes called the ‘causal closure’ or the ‘causal completeness’ of the physical world. This principle says that all physical effects have physical causes which are enough to bring them about. The problem then is simple: how can a mental cause have a physical effect if that effect also has a physical cause which is enough to bring it about? Barring massive overdetermination of our actions by independent causes, it seems that the best answer is to identify the mental and the physical causes. And this is traditionally how physicalists have argued for their identity theory of mind and body. However, many physicalists reject the identity theory, and therefore they have to solve the mental causation problem in some other way. At present, there is no consensus among physicalists on which of the currently proposed solutions is correct. In chapter 2 of EM I propose an alternative, which I call ‘emergentism’.
